n. A weatherman that insists on reporting from hurricaine ground zero, mid-blizzard or at the beach when the tsunami hits. (origin - contraction of Cantore and Moron)
Channel 5 has their Cantoron reporting on Hurricane Katrina from downtown New Orleans!

How many Cantorons does the Weather Channel employ?
by JandBinAZ February 01, 2011